Thermo Scientific™ Brilliance™ Candida Agar / Sabouraud GC Agar
Description
Isolate fungi and differentiate and presumptively identify Candida albicans and Candida tropicalis from clinical specimens with this bi-plate.
Isolate fungi and differentiate and presumptively identify Candida albicans and Candida tropicalis from clinical specimens, with ready-to-use Thermo Scientific™ Brilliance™ Candida Agar / Sabouraud GC Agar, a single bi-plate which includes two separate formulations. The Sabouraud GC medium creates selective conditions for isolation and cultivation of fungi while Brilliance™ Candida Agar enables the isolation and differentiation of Candida albicans and Candida tropicalis from other Candida spp. within 48 hours. The convenient bi-plate format frees up incubation space.
Use Brilliance™ Candida Agar / Sabouraud GC Agar for isolation of fungi and presumptive identification Candida albicans and Candida tropicalis from other Candida spp. from clinical specimens.
- Suitable for identification of pathogenic fungi from material containing large numbers of other fungi or bacteria
- Easy isolation, differentiation and presumptive identification of Candida albicans and Candida tropicalis from other Candida within 48 hours.
- Ready-to-use convenience of prepared media.
- Space saving bi-plate format.
Brilliance Candida Agar incorporates two chromogens that indicate the presence of the target enzymes. As a result, Candida tropicalis form dark blue colonies while Candida albicans form Green colored colonies.
